A Sneak Peak of The Grand America's Holiday Window Displays

Local Park City artist Jonnie Parker Hartman is the mastermind behind this year’s Grand America Hotel holiday window displays. For the past six months, Hartman has collaborated with a group of talented artist, on over 2200 hours of sketching, hand-crafting and construction. From November 9 to the 12, Hartman will be installing the art pieces for their grand unveiling on November 22.

The year’s windows, titled “Holidays around the World” features a penguin named Maurice as he travels through 17 different countries. Other fun designs to look out for include a hand-stitched 5-foot Loch Ness Monster, 250 glittered and painted pieces, five dozen hand-made tulips and a life-sized set Russian stacking dolls.
